What is the digital signature lawfulness for mortgage in Australia

The digital signature lawfulness for mortgage in Australia refers to the legal framework that recognizes electronic signatures as valid and enforceable in mortgage transactions. Under the Electronic Transactions Act 1999, electronic signatures are considered equivalent to traditional handwritten signatures, provided they meet specific criteria. This law ensures that digital signatures used in mortgage documents carry the same legal weight as their paper counterparts, facilitating smoother transactions in the digital age.

Legal use of the digital signature lawfulness for mortgage in Australia

The legal use of digital signatures in mortgage transactions in Australia is governed by the Electronic Transactions Act, which stipulates that electronic signatures are legally binding if they meet certain conditions. These conditions include the signer's consent, the ability to verify the signature's authenticity, and the security of the signed document. By adhering to these legal requirements, users can confidently engage in mortgage transactions using digital signatures.
